I photographed this non-breeding plumaged cisticola on the circuit through the upper part of Suikerbosrand Nature Reserve, south of Johannesburg. It was giving a very high, thin whispery sub-song which consisted of various, different “tsee” notes both from the ground and on the grass stem it flew up to. It didn’t call in the air [...]

Grey-backed Cisticola Cisticola subruficapilla
Karoo, Cape Province, South Africa. September 2006
The Grey-backed Cisticola is a SW African endemic, associated with lowland fynbos, karoo scrub, and arid hillsides - typically in drier habitats than the closely related Wailing Cisticola.
These birds were part of a family group photographed moving through acacia bushes alongside a dry stream [...]
